Erratum to 'The derivation of radionuclide transfer parameters for and dose-rates to an adult ringed seal (Phoca hispida) in an Arctic environment' [J. Environ. Radioact. 90 (2006) 197-209]

The authors regret that an incorrect value was used for the liver fractional organ mass. Instead of the stated value of 0.6%, a value of 2.7% should have been used as reported by Crile and Quiring (1940) leading to the underestimation of a number of derived values pertaining to ~(210)Po, ~(210)Pb, ~(238)Pu and ~(239,240)Pu. Using a value of 2.7%, the derived effective half-life and biological half-life for ~(210)Po is 61 and 108 days, respectively (using an assumed assimilation efficiency of 0.1), while the total dose-rate for an adult ringed seal is approximately 0.21 μGy h~(-1) (equivalent to circa 1.8 mGy a~(-1)). Individual corrected affected values are given in Tables 2-4.
